At the end of the lesson, I’ll give you an example of how you can string them together into a … oramorph ampullenWebAlt picking is probably one of the most important techniques you will learn on guitar in general, but absolutely mandatory for shredding. Start doing scales up and down purely alt picking. Go as slow as you need to, but make sure you are alt picking every step including string transitions. oramorph alternatives
